CentOS 7.6与7.9的内核版本对比
结论
CentOS 7.6默认内核版本为3.10.0-957,而CentOS 7.9升级至3.10.0-1160。两者均基于长期支持(LTS)的Linux 3.10内核分支,但7.9通过后续更新修复了更多安全漏洞并优化了稳定性。
详细对比
1. 默认内核版本
-
CentOS 7.6
- 初始发布内核:
3.10.0-957.el7.x86_64 - 属于7.6版本的基准内核,发布于2018年12月。
- 初始发布内核:
-
CentOS 7.9
- 初始发布内核:
3.10.0-1160.el7.x86_64 - 作为7系列的最终版本(2020年9月发布),集成了更多补丁和向后移植的功能。
- 初始发布内核:
2. 内核更新差异
-
安全修复
- 7.9的内核包含截至2020年的所有关键安全补丁,例如针对Spectre/Meltdown漏洞的修复更完善。
- 7.6用户需通过
yum update手动升级内核才能获得相同保护。
-
硬件与驱动支持
- 7.9对新型硬件(如NVMe SSD、网卡驱动)的兼容性更好,部分功能通过向后移植实现。
3. 如何检查当前内核版本
运行以下命令查看系统实际内核版本(与安装镜像的默认版本可能不同):
uname -r
4. 升级建议
- 若使用7.6:建议至少升级到
3.10.0-1160系列内核,以获取安全更新:yum update kernel - 长期规划:CentOS 7已停止维护(EOL为2024年6月),应优先迁移至AlmaLinux/Rocky Linux或CentOS Stream。
关键总结
- CentOS 7.9的内核(3.10.0-1160)比7.6(3.10.0-957)更安全、稳定,且是官方推荐的最终版本。
- 所有CentOS 7用户需尽快制定迁移计划,避免因EOL导致的安全风险。
轻量云Cloud